I applied for this position at my school's career fair back in September, and online. I was invited to an on-demand interview in October (which is super chill tbh) where you can record answers to your questions any number of times you want.
In November, I advanced to the second round of interviews, this time an in-person interview. This one is pretty chill, mainly behavioral along with an easy technical question (mix of system design and algorithms).
